Updated Status Display for Legacy Asset Rollup Lines
The system now displays the rollup line of a legacy asset with Status=New instead of Existing during change operations on migrated assets. This update clarifies asset status in the cart when no asset line item is associated with the rollup line.
Managing Custom Pricing Fields by Flow
The system allows administrators to manage Custom Pricing Fields per flow, including Default, System, and Quoting Cart Grid, to support different behaviors. When no flow is specified, the system uses Config System Properties as a fallback.
For more information, see Config System Properties.
Remaining Turbo Pricing Status in Pending State
Turbo-priced cart lines may remain in Pending status when a Cost Model is linked to the Price List, which prevents cart finalization even after pricing completes. This occurs when post-pricing updates reset the Pricing Status to Pending without triggering a follow-up Turbo pricing call. Reactivating the cart resets the status to Completed and allows finalization.

| 00968673 | CPQ-107932 | Collaboration Request carts do not launch with the expected flow when the Collaboration Request cart flow differs from the main cart. When using the Apttus_Config2_Cart page instead of Apttus_Config2_CollabRequestInline, the system ignores the flow specified in the URL and continues to use the flow from the original cart, resulting in unexpected behavior. The system recommends using the Cart page for Collaboration Requests instead of CollabRequestInline. It allows specifying a different flow through the Cart URL when required. It limits differences between flows to Display Column Settings only to maintain consistent behavior. For more information, see Working with the Collaboration Request. |
| 00964630 | CPQ-107180 | System.LimitException occurs when orphan temporary objects are fetched during API calls, exceeding the query row limit of 50,001 in Salesforce. This issue arises when the AddMultiProduct API and GetProductsForPriceList API are used within the same transaction, and the price list includes categories or is based on another price list. |
| 00966157 | CPQ-107150 | Bundle lines and option rollup lines are duplicated during new sale and change operations when ramp dates are altered, causing misalignment between option and bundle ramps. |
| 00965547 | CPQ-106939 | The system assigns an incorrect start date when users add option products during asset amendment. It derives the date from the earliest charge line in the bundle instead of respecting the option’s charge type, which can also update the primary bundle line start date and impact the selling term. |
| 00961710 | CPQ-106123 | When switching from Unlimited to Per Package, the system may not fully revert the previously applied constraint rules, which can result in incorrect product selections or validation messages remaining in the configuration. |

| CPQ-107714 | Duplicate rollup lines are created during amendments when using the amend API and updating pricing on the same cart. This issue occurs regardless of the presence of price ramps or asset pricing configurations. |
| CPQ-107667 | Refine your Search functionality does not enable other checkboxes when a selected checkbox is deselected, if Smart Search is enabled. Additionally, reselecting a previously deselected checkbox does not filter products as expected. |
